HOLLAND, MI (WHTC) – An apparently quiet work-study session awaits Holland City Council members this evening. Linda Jacobs of Good Samaritan Ministries updates the Landlord Energy Efficiency Upgrade Revolving Loan Program, and Dave Koster of the Holland BPW has the latest involving Holland Energy Park construction. What makes this session notable is that it is scheduled to be the last overseen by Kurt Dykstra as Mayor, as he begins his new duties as Trinity Christian College’s President one week from today, but some City Hall observers believe that he may not be attending.
